Abstract :
We study the decay Bc → Ds∗γ. There are two mechanisms contributing to the process. One proceeds through the short distance b → sγ transition and the other occurs through weak annihilation accompanied by a photon emission. The electromagnetic penguin contribution is estimated by perturbative QCD and found to be 4.68 × 10−18 GeV. In particular, we find the contribution of the weak annihilation is 6.25 × 10−18 GeV which is in the same order as that of the electromagnetic penguin. The total decay rate Γ(Bc → Ds∗γ) is predicted to be 1.45 × 10−17 GeV and the branching ratio Br(Bc → Ds∗γ) is predicted to be 2.98 × 10−5 for τBc = 1.35 ps. The the decays Bc → Ds∗γ can be well studied at LHC i the near future.
